The sum of two even numbers is 6 more than twice of the smaller number. If the difference between these two numbers is 6, then which is definitely the smaller number? [IBPS RRB (PO) 2014] |
A) 18
B) 20
C) Data provided are not adequate to answer the question
D) 12
E) 24
Correct Answer: C
Solution :
Let the first even number be \[x.\] |
Then, second even number is \[x+6.\] |
Now, \[x+x+6=2x+6\] |
\[\Rightarrow \] \[2x+6=2x+6\] |
Hence, data provided is not sufficient. |
